Chiropractic care is often very effective for headache pain. Many headaches have their origins in the cervical or upper spine (neck). Your neck is made up of several bones (vertebrae) and disks and the upper spine can get out of its natural alignment, causing pain. This can be caused by improper posture, stress, working conditions, injury, and repetitive activities.

The neck can be the source of head pain due to the nerves within the cervical spine. When those nerves are compressed they can become sensitive and this may create pain sensations. It also may cause unpleasant conditions in the head like throbbing pain, dizziness, or loss of balance. A chiropractor can help with these issues.
